From the tools to the drawing board

I trained and worked as an electrician before moving into electrical design — I now work day-to-day designing industrial power distribution equipment, and that work increasingly spans lighting schemes and the control and metering systems that sit alongside them.

SILec Design is the independent side of that work — power, lighting and controls design for contractors and panel builders who need accurate drawings without carrying a full-time design engineer.
